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Manningtree to Cantley start from as little as £8.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Manningtree to Cantley are available for £20.20 one way, or £32.40 return

Everything you need to know about Manningtree Station

Discovering Manningtree Train Station

Situated in the picturesque region of Essex, Manningtree station is more than just a simple stop along your journey. This station offers a seamless blend of travel convenience and the charm of its surrounding English countryside. Whether commuting to the bustling city of London or exploring the nearby towns, it’s an ideal starting point for multiple travel adventures.

Station Facilities and Services

Manningtree station is equipped to handle all your ticketing needs efficiently. The ticket office operates from 05:45 to 20: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:50 to 19:15 on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for those who prefer self-service, and they are accessible for disabled passengers as well.

Passengers are well-supported at the station with a dedicated help point, customer information screens, and staff assistance available throughout the week. Both the help point and information screens guide travelers effectively, ensuring that their journeys are as smooth as possible. Although there are no lost property or luggage storage services, Manningtree offers a safe environment with CCTV in operation.

Accessibility and Comfort

The station is categorized as a B2 facility, indicating a high level of accessibility. It provides step-free access across platforms via lifts, which are open around the clock. With accessible ticket machines, an induction loop for hearing-aid users, and accessible toilets, Manningtree caters to all passengers thoughtfully. While the car park operates 24/7 with plenty of spaces, those seeking other modes of travel will find the absence of accessible taxis might limit them, but train ramps and meeting points are available to assist those with mobility challenges.

Onward Travel from Manningtree

The transport links at Manningtree extend beyond just rail. For those times when rail services face disruptions, a rail replacement bus service is conveniently located at the station forecourt, ensuring continuity of travel with minimal fuss. Cycling enthusiasts will appreciate the ample bike storage solutions ranging from compounds to racks, all weather-protected and monitored by CCTV.

Everything you need to know about Cantley Station

Cantley Train Station: A Gateway to East Anglia

Nestled in the picturesque east of England, Cantley train station serves as a quaint yet functional rail waypoint on your journey through the Norfolk Broads. While small, the station provides the essential services needed for a smooth travel experience, connecting you seamlessly to the charming landscapes and bustling cities of East Anglia.

Facilities at Cantley Train Station

Despite lacking a formal ticket office, Cantley station is well-equipped with ticket machines that cater to both regular and accessible customers. You can effortlessly collect your tickets bought online at these machines. Additionally, the station is fitted with an induction loop for the hearing impaired, making it more inclusive for travelers with specific needs.

Although there are no waiting rooms or lounges at Cantley, there is available seating. The station's step-free access is rated as category B1, ensuring relatively easy mobility for individuals with physical challenges. When assistance is needed, help points and a customer service helpline are available to support travelers from 8 AM to 8 PM, Monday through Sunday.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Upon arriving at Cantley, you'll find essential transport links to continue your journey. Recognizing the rural charm of the area, rail replacement services via mini-buses provide an alternative when train services face disruptions. These mini-buses are strategically stationed for pick up and drop off near the Sugar Beet factory exit on Station Road, ensuring your travel remains uninterrupted.
